What is a space elevator and how does it work?

Space elevator refers to a type of space transportation system which is proposed by many scientists and inventors. Its main component is a ribbon-like cable also called "tether" which is anchored to the surface and extending into the space.

How does the elevator work?

Passenger elevators are big pulleys powered by a motor with 6-8 cables or more that pull the elevator cab or the counter weight letting the elevator go up or down.


Will a space elevator ever be built?

As of now (2008) technology it is not practical to make materials that are sufficiently strong and light to build an Earth based space elevator. This is because the weight of conventional materials needed to construct such a structure would be far too great.
